• Home
  • Blog
  • SEO
  • What to Expect from a Professional SEO Company
Professional SEO Company
  • July 8, 2025
  • by 

What to Expect from a Professional SEO Company

In a digital-first world, having a beautiful website isn’t enough—you need visibility. That’s where SEO (Search Engine Optimization) comes in. But with thousands of freelancers and agencies offering SEO services, how do you know what’s worth your investment?

Hiring a professional SEO company should feel like a strategic partnership, not a gamble. In this blog, we’ll break down exactly what you should expect when working with an expert SEO firm—no smoke, no mirrors—just results.

1. Customized SEO Strategy — Not One-Size-Fits-All

A professional SEO company doesn’t give you a pre-packaged solution. Instead, they craft a custom SEO strategy based on:

  • Your industry and target audience
  • Website performance and current rankings
  • Competitor analysis
  • Location (local, national, or international SEO needs)

You should expect a deep discovery process, including audits, keyword research, and goal alignment before the campaign even begins. If you’re outsourcing SEO internationally, it’s vital to find a company that aligns with your goals. Learn more in our blog on outsourcing SEO services from USA to India.

2. Comprehensive SEO Audit

Before any work starts, a complete website audit is crucial. A reliable SEO company will analyze:

  • Technical SEO issues (speed, crawlability, indexing)
  • On-page elements (content, headers, meta tags)
  • Backlink profile and off-page authority
  • Keyword rankings and search visibility
  • Mobile-friendliness and UX

This audit forms the foundation of the entire SEO strategy.

3. Transparent Reporting and Metrics

A professional SEO company provides clear, honest reporting, not just vanity metrics.

Expect regular updates on:

  • Keyword rankings
  • Website traffic (organic vs. paid)
  • Conversion tracking (form fills, calls, sales)
  • Backlink acquisition
  • Bounce rates and user behavior

Monthly reports with tools like Google Analytics, Search Console, and third-party platforms (like SEMrush or Ahrefs) should be the norm.

4. Clear Communication and Strategic Guidance

SEO isn’t a one-time job—it’s an ongoing process. A reliable SEO partner will:

  • Assign a dedicated account manager or strategist
  • Schedule regular meetings (weekly or monthly)
  • Keep you informed about changes in algorithms or direction
  • Share insights and ideas that align with your business goals

Professional SEO companies build long-term relationships, not just short-term wins.

5. On-Page Optimization Services

Once your site is audited, the company will optimize key on-site elements such as:

  • Title tags, meta descriptions, and header tags
  • Keyword placements and content updates
  • Internal linking structures
  • Alt text for images
  • Mobile usability and page speed improvements

This is critical to helping search engines understand and rank your content.

6. Technical SEO Enhancements

Even if your content is great, poor technical setup can prevent it from ranking. You can expect technical services like:

  • Schema markup implementation
  • XML sitemap creation and robots.txt updates
  • Canonicalization to prevent duplicate content
  • Core Web Vitals improvement
  • HTTPS and SSL configuration

A pro SEO company makes your website “search-engine friendly” from the inside out.

7. High-Quality Content Creation

Content is still king—and a top-tier SEO agency knows it. Expect services such as:

  • Blog writing and content calendars
  • Product or service page optimization
  • Location-specific content (for local SEO)
  • Long-form educational content for authority building
  • Content designed to rank in featured snippets or answer boxes

They may also incorporate AI-friendly formats optimized for modern search platforms. Learn more about this evolving landscape in our guide to Search Generative Experience.

8. Link Building and Off-Page SEO

One of the most powerful (and misunderstood) aspects of SEO is link building. A professional SEO company will pursue:

  • High-authority backlinks from credible sources
  • Guest blogging opportunities
  • Digital PR for brand mentions
  • Local citations and directories for local SEO
  • Removing toxic or spammy backlinks

Ethical, white-hat link building should be expected—not black-hat tricks that can get your site penalized.

9. Local SEO (If Relevant)

If your business serves a specific geographic area, a professional SEO company will provide local SEO services, such as:

  • Google Business Profile optimization
  • Local keyword targeting
  • Geo-specific landing pages
  • Local citations
  • Managing customer reviews and ratings

Need more clarity on different optimization types? See how Answer Engine Optimization (AEO) compares to traditional SEO strategies.

10. Long-Term Value, Not Overnight Results

A reputable SEO company will never promise “#1 ranking overnight.” Instead, they’ll focus on long-term growth, including:

  • Sustainable traffic increases
  • Improved domain authority
  • Higher conversion rates
  • Ongoing keyword expansion
  • Adapting to Google algorithm updates

Wondering how to navigate Google’s core updates? Read our in-depth post on surviving Google algorithm updates for tips that real pros follow.

Red Flags to Watch Out For

Not all that glitters is gold. If your SEO provider does any of the following, reconsider:

Guarantees #1 rankings overnight
Hides or avoids showing reports
Uses shady backlink schemes
Doesn’t ask about your business goals
Doesn’t optimize for mobile or speed

Final Thoughts: Choose Wisely, Grow Confidently

Hiring a professional SEO company can transform your business—but only if you choose a partner that values transparency, strategy, and long-term success.

Whether you’re a small local shop or a national brand, working with a credible SEO agency ensures your digital foundation is strong and future-ready.

If you’re ready to start climbing the search rankings with an experienced team, explore what SEO Quartz can do for your business.

FAQs: Working with a Professional SEO Company

How long should I work with an SEO company?

SEO is ongoing. Expect to work with a provider for at least 6–12 months for meaningful results.

What should I budget for SEO services?

Costs vary, but small to medium businesses should expect to invest between $800 and $3000+ per month depending on scope.

How do I know if my SEO is working?

Your SEO company should provide monthly reports with key metrics like rankings, traffic, and conversions.

Can I do SEO myself?

You can handle the basics, but effective SEO requires time, tools, and expertise. Partnering with professionals yields better ROI.

Make a comment

Your email adress will not be published. Required field are marked*

Prev
Next
Drag
Map